今天给大家分享vue小程序开发入门,其中也会对vuejs 小程序的内容是什么进行解释。
mpvue是一个类vue的小程序框架,帮助开发者提高效率,增加开发体验,开发者只需要熟悉vue的api语法使用即可上手。官方还提供了了基于@vue/cli脚手架的快速开发方式。执行 操作以上步骤即可初始化一个mpvue的初始化项目。这样mpvue的入门就完成了。
使用mpvue和uni-app开发小程序的优点和缺点:mpvue:优点:Vue.js生态:mpvue基于Vue.js框架,继承了Vue.js丰富的生态系统,开发者可以充分利用Vue.js的特性和插件。组件化开发:支持Vue.js的组件化开发,代码结构清晰,便于模块化和复用。
uni-app框架:uni-app是一个基于Vue.js的开发框架,可以同时开发多个平台的小程序,如微信、支付宝、百度等。 Taro框架:Taro是一个多端开发框架,支持小程序、HReact Native等多个平台,可以实现一次编写,多端运行。
咱们首先来说说自学:对于自学最直接的方法就是看***学习,看的过程自己也要动手写代码,不要以为看看***就能懂,多写多练,才能从实践中知道自己的不足。但自学者对于前端学习没有一个清晰的知识体系,除了HTML、CSS、JavaScript这些前端基础外,其他前端内容不知道先学哪一个?学到怎么样的程度。
小程序与APP开发 现在移动应用越来越受欢迎,掌握了小程序和APP开发技术可以增强自身竞争力,这就需要掌握小程序的开发基础;能够独立开发小程序项目;能够掌握Canvas的使用;能够掌握小程序的部署与发布;能够掌握小程序开发框架mpvue的使用;掌握第三方AI平台的使用。
基础部分,主要就是html、css、JavaScript。这个其实不用多讲,这些个基础不学扎实了啥也干不了,可以直接从htmlcssES5来学习。学习的方法很多,最方便的方法是像w3cschool、汇智网这种边学边练的,类似之前微软的所见即所得,喜欢读纸质书的可以买几本书来看看。
步骤一:注册微信小程序和微信支付商户号 访问mp.weixin.qq/扫码登录微信公众号,在左侧栏点击“小程序管理”,然后点击“快速注册并认证小程序”到下一步;按照要求进行填写,完成注册。步骤二:选择制作类型 市场上,做微信小程序大多都是***用模板化开发,模板化开发比较合适中小企业。
申请小程序账号 第一步就是在微信公众平台申请小程序账号并认证。因为是制作支持在线交易的购物商城小程序,所以在小程序认证时,选择的主体类型必须是有营业执照的企业或个体工商户,个人是无法申请的。
去微信小程序***下载相应版本的“微信开发者工具”。微信扫码,登录“微信开发者工具”。进入小程序后,点击“添加”。进入添加后,填写“新项目参数”,点击“新建”。进入新项目后,可以在相应的区域“开发小程序”。
app 的根组件上添加名为 onError 的回调函数即可。如下:以下使用mpvue创建一个小程序 执行npm run dev 后可以看到生成 dist/wx的路径,将生成的文件目录导入小程序开发工具即可。这样就搭建好了一个基本的mpvue小程序, 可以基于以上创建我们自己的项目。
前端开发:使用小程序开发框架(如微信小程序原生开发、Taro、Mpvue等)进行前端开发。根据设计稿和需求,在前端页面中实现商城的各项功能和交互逻辑。 后端开发:根据需求,开发后台接口和逻辑。您可以选择使用服务器端技术(如Node.js、Python等)来处理前端请求、操作数据库等。
小程序的优点:小程序有专门的入口 小程序和公众号一个很好的区别就是入口不同。小程序在发现界面有一个专门的入口,通过这个入口,用户可以找到自己曾经使用过的小程序。入口的不同,说明小程序和微信公众号定位是完全不同的两种。
移动app的缺点屏幕限制不同手机的屏幕大小有差异,而用户总是希望使用自己特定的手机上所有可用的屏幕空间,这样开发者不可避免需要为不同的手机移植优化同一款游戏。应用程序大小限制虽然在一些新款智能手机上可以运行几兆字节的应用程序,但大部分手机只有很小的内存空间供应用程序使用。
小程序日益火爆,越来越多商家选择小程序,小程序优点:方便快捷,即用即走。不需要再下载什么APP啦,既费流量,又占空间内存。小程序就是方便,即用即走。速度快、不占内存 因为小程序前端代码都是存在微信服务器上的,在腾讯云端存放呢,所以无需加载,直接就打开了,速度也比较快。
不知道你想说的是什么品类和什么平台?我来谈谈微信小程序吧,缺点就是必须依附大平台才可以正常运作,不止接受国家法律,还要接受平台的管理规则,还有很多特色的功能不一定能推出。依附单一平台的推广性也相对狭隘。
它基于Vue.js框架,并使用了一些其他技术来实现跨平台功能。关于UniApp所使用的版本,具体取决于您当前正在使用的UniApp版本以及您想要构建的目标平台。如果是uni-app那就选uview(完美,好用),兼顾满足小程序、APP、H5等。如果是Angular那就选Ionic(一对好CP)。uniapp开发工具没有手机版。
如果对Vue比较熟悉的话,上手还是比较快的,很方便前端人员进行开发。其实和平时使用vue差不多,只有一些小小的差异。开发的时候注意一下就行。uni-app可以打包android,ios,微信小程序,h5等运行。兼容性这块的话,大部分都算比较好,在不同端没有不同表现,地图的操作上稍微会有一些不同。
1、微信小程序一直的宗旨就是触手可及的体验,再伴随着微信移动端的巨大流量,小程序开发的前景在未来会更好。想要学习小程序开发的小伙伴,只需要学习一些网站开发的基本知识技能,在多动手自己练习一些项目,相信很快就能够自己亲自开发出一款小程序。需要掌握一些基础技术代码,主要是HTML、CSS、javaScript。
2、微信小程序开发知识点 开发小程序需要掌握哪些知识点 开发小程序需要掌握以下几方面: 小程序的功能是否齐全小程序是一种工具,如果这个工具少一些功能,那这个工具就是废的,用不了。
3、前期阶段:建议从HTML-》 CSS -》 JAVASCRIPT-》JQUERY 开始,0基础均可学习。中期阶段:建议了解一些知识,精通最好。比如一些基础框架和知识 :bootstrap jssdk ajax json http https 协议等,在这里就可以开始学习小程序了,里面语法相似angular ,差别也多。
4、通微信小程序需要完成注册、认证和开发等一系列流程,以下是详细步骤:注册:访问微信公众平台,使用微信账号注册一个小程序账号。需要选择主体类型(个人或企业)并提交相关身份信息。实名认证:注册完成后,需要进行实名认证。企业需要提交营业执照等有效证件;个人需要提交个人身份证等信息。
5、为方便初学者了解微信小程序的基本代码结构,在创建过程中,如果选择的本地文件夹是个空文件夹,开发者工具会提示,是否需要创建一个 quick start 项目。选择「是」,开发者工具会帮助我们在开发目录里生成一个简单的 demo。
6、工具使用教程:网页搜索小程序平台,进入小程序搭建系统,如图1。进入平台右上角点击“注册”按钮,如图2。编辑一个用户名、密码,输入验证码并确认注册协议,如图3。编辑一个小程序名字、录入手机号码和找回密码的邮箱账号,如图4。数字产品类型选择界面,选择小程序,如图5。
深入JavaScript面向对象编程实战ES6,让你的代码更具企业级效率Ajax教程,掌握异步更新技术的奥秘Promise教程,让异步编程不再混乱Git与node.js,全栈之旅从这里开始,实战项目一网打尽框架进阶: Vue 2/3与React - 深入混合应用开发,微信小程序与uni-app实战。
首先要从基本的HTML语言开始学起。网页的所有内容都是建立在HTML的基础之上,要想学好HTML,不要去使用任何集成工具,而是使用文本编辑器,直接从最简单的HTML可以写起。首先上网下载notepad++文本编辑器,一个好的文本编辑工具能达到事半功倍的效果。
第七阶段:大数据可视化 内容包含:(大数据可视化化基础与实战、数据可视化入门、D.js详解、其他JS库)对于想学习web前端的同学来说:首先是自学,其实自学也不是不可以,只要有毅力能坚持,自己学习是完全没有问题的,现在有很多同学也是自己找资料***来学习。
小程序开发需要的技术:1,前端基础:Html、JS、css。2,后端语言:php、java任何一门语言都可以。3,学习微信接口文档,后期开发过程中如果用到了支付、分享等功能的话,只需要加个jssdk就可以了。4,美工、ui设计,如果想要小程序整洁有美感的话,就需要美工制作界面。
目前小程序的开发有三种方式,具体详情如下:自己有多年的编程基础,自己学习,自己研究。使用第三方小程序开发工具这种方式是使用第三方的小程序开发工具,比如我就是使用的牛刀云。这类工具一般都不需要编程。区别于微信小程序官方的代码编辑器,这类工具是图形化的界面。做小程序就像做PPT一样。
组件式开发、重构、复用等,都需要学的,慕课网有相关课程,课程不仅仅讲解小程序开发,更会通过实际的编码来传递一些编程的经典思想。
高扩展性的网络通信应用,Mina提供了事件驱动、异步(Mina的异步IO默认使用的是JAVANIO作为底层支持)操作的编程模型。这个框架为微信小程序的运行提供了丰富的组件和API。微信小程序开发者要学会和掌握小程序的框架结构、数据绑定机制、模板、数据缓存、常用组件和API等相关知识。
寻找第三方开发公司合作 虽然小程序开发的费用没有APP费用高,它的构建系统也没有APP复杂,但是一般情况下公司和商户都还不具备小程序开发的能力,所以大家就需要寻找专业的第三方开发公司合作,通过他们专业的技能来为自己打造一个专属的小程序,并且找第三方开发公司合作比自己组建开发团队的费用更低。
关于vue小程序开发入门,以及vuejs 小程序的相关信息分享结束,感谢你的耐心阅读,希望对你有所帮助。